ABSTRACT:
A method is disclosed for accelerating the stretching of skin and the closing of open skin wounds which includes the steps of attaching a plurality of anchors, which have fasteners attached to one side of the anchors, to the surface of the skin adjacent to the wound with an adhesive whereby the anchors are spaced around the wound in a manner to allow at least one strap with a plurality of fastener receivers to be positioned across the wound and the fastener receivers to be coupled to the fasteners. At least one strap with the fastener receivers is positioned across the wound. The fasteners are coupled to a plurality of the fastener receivers which are attached to at least one strap. The tension of at least one strap is adjusted to maintain sufficient tension to stretch the skin proximate to the fasteners thereby significantly accelerating wound closure.
